This PR adds the Vellick dispatch simulator for the Towerline project. It models car assignment under morning-peak traffic using a simple cost function: wait time plus projected stops. The scenario loader reads floor-demand profiles from fixtures, so new team members can add cases without touching the engine. Tuning happens entirely through the constants shown below.

tuning table, kajog-bawip:
TIERS = {
    "kelius": 256,
    "lammir": 543,
}

Handover: user-module extraction from the Cartwheel monolith

Auth and profile endpoints now route through the new Userhive service. Session tokens re-issued at the boundary; old cookie format rejected after cutover. Review the secrets handling and the mTLS setup between services — that's the main risk area. Current service configuration for your review follows.

deployment values, fahap-hahaf:
[casdor]
port = 9200
region = south-2
host = casdor.qirvanworks.corp
timeout_ms = 3000
retries = 4

CSV Import Wizard (Tablepost) — support runbook fragment.

Symptoms: stuck at "Mapping columns" or silent row drops. First steps: confirm file under 50MB and UTF-8 encoded. Check the import job status in the admin console; failed jobs show a reason code. Codes 40x are user-fixable (bad headers, duplicate keys). Codes 50x: escalate to the Tablepost on-call. Never re-run an import marked PARTIAL without clearing staged rows first. Full reason-code table is maintained here:

wiki page, fahaf-yagag: https://confluence.qorvellabs.internal/pages/display/pages/display

Subject: On-call handover — orders soft deletes

Hi Marek,

Quick note before you take over. We shipped the soft-delete change to the Cartwheel orders table last night: rows now get a deleted_at timestamp instead of being removed. Plugin authors querying orders directly must filter on deleted_at IS NULL, or they'll see ghost orders. The compat view orders_active handles this automatically. Docs are updated in the Cartwheel developer portal. If plugin authors hit anything weird, route them to the integrations inbox.

escalation mailbox, tafop-fahif: oliael@tolvaqlabs.corp